On the morning of July 9, Ho Chi Minh City Information Technology Association (HCA) coordinated with other units to officially open the iTECH EXPO 2025 International Technology Fair and Exhibition, held at the SKY EXPO Vietnam International Convention and Exhibition Center (Quang Trung Software Park, Ho Chi Minh City).
Mr. Lam Nguyen Hai Long - Chairman of HCA, Head of the Organizing Committee - said that iTECH EXPO 2025 will take place in 3 days, from now until July 11.
The event gathered more than 120 domestic and foreign technology enterprises, displaying core technologies such as AI, internet of things, big data, interactive technologies such as robots, drones, holoboxes... and specialized application solutions in education, agriculture , finance...

"iTECH EXPO 2025 will be a meeting point connecting solution providers, application businesses and government agencies, to together shape a sustainable digital future, not only for Vietnam but also for the region," said Mr. Lam Nguyen Hai Long.
According to the organizers, the event is expected to attract more than 5,000 visitors and over 1,000 business connections. In particular, there will be participation from nearly 10 markets including Russia, Korea, China, UK, Israel, Malaysia, Cambodia, Laos...

One of the highlights of the event on the morning of July 9 was the booth of Au Lac Technology and Media Application Company Limited (Alta Media), where humanoid robots were displayed.
According to Mr. Nguyen Thanh Cong, representative of Alta Media, this robot is designed to replace workers in production lines, performing tasks such as screwing, welding, arranging, picking and packing. In addition, the robot can also replace security workers and warehouse supervisors, with the ability to detect fires thanks to being equipped with cameras and surrounding sensors.
"With an operating time of 3-4 hours after each full charge, the robot will automatically return to the charging station when the battery is low and takes about 1 hour to fully recharge" - Mr. Cong introduced.
Alta Media representative said the initial price of this humanoid robot is about 2 billion VND, with a 5-year warranty. However, the robot is still in the display and testing phase, to perfect its features and fix errors.
Many attendees commented that the robot was quite attractive and impressive, however its mobility and operation were still not perfect and needed further improvement.
